Tarta Helada Seeds
Tarta Helada is a feminized hybrid built from Ice Cream Cake x Girl Scout Cookies (Forum Cut). It brings together dense flowers, striking color, and a loud sugary profile that feels rich from the first pull. This cultivar stays expressive, resin-heavy, and easy to enjoy.
Mamiko Seeds developed this cross within its Cookies collection, working with this line in Europe since 2013.
Its parental line includes Ice Cream Cake, a 2019 Emerald Cup winner, which adds creamy depth and sweet vanilla character to the final profile.
Tarta Helada grows with indica-style structure, good vigor, and a manageable frame. It asks for little fuss, handles lighter feeding well, and rewards growers with strong resin production for dry sift or ice water extractions. Tarta Helada Characteristics
Strain type: Feminized
Genetics: Ice Cream Cake x Girl Scout Cookies (Forum Cut)
Indica/Sativa: Indica/Sativa hybrid
THC: 20–25%
Effect: Energetic cerebral lift followed by balanced relaxation
Flavor: Sweet cream, vanilla, sugary dough, kush
Indoor yield: 500 g/m² (17.6 oz/10.7 ft²)
Outdoor yield: High
Flowering time: 8–9 weeks
Height: Manageable
Structure: Indica-style, vigorous, compact
Bud appearance: Dense buds with pretty coloration and heavy resin
Difficulty level: Beginner-friendly
Best cultivation technique: Light feeding early, then support resin production late in flower
